Air force chief shot at

The head of Zimbabwe's air force, a close ally of President Robert Mugabe, was shot and wounded in an assassination attempt at the weekend, state media said yesterday.

The shooting of Air Marshal Perence Shiri on Saturday appeared to be part of attacks against high profile figures designed to destabilize the country, Minister of Home Affairs Kembo Mohadi was quoted in the Herald newspaper as saying.
